It's not really a production vs non-prod thing. In order to run the full lap they have to shut down the track, so most tests are run the shorter length during industry testing days where any manufacturer could be coming on/off the track. Barely anyone ever tests the full lap so when people say Nurburgring times, they usually mean the shorter lap. There's some more info about it on the Nurburgring times wiki page.
